Hazard-ous: Lampard reveals how Chelsea can fix Hazard's form


Frank Lampard believes Eden Hazard “needs help” at Chelsea but insists Jose Mourinho should not rest the Belgian.

The 24-year-old has been unable to replicate last season’s blistering form which led to him win the PFA Player of the Year as well as his first Premier League title since joining Stamford Bridge in 2012.
And Lampard, who won 11 trophies during his 13-year-stint at Chelsea, feels Hazard needs his confidence restored.
“I love Eden Hazard as a player, I was fortunate enough to play with him, his ability is frightening,” Lampard said onSky Sports’ ‘Monday Night Football’.
“He’s come out himself about his level [of performance] this year but I think he needs help.
“I think we forget he’s a young boy, he’s come onto the scene these last couple of years, he’s never had a moment like this in his career. He’s never had to worry. He’s generally played very well, last year he was creating all season, and was the difference for Chelsea to a big extent.
“At the minute he looks like a player down on his confidence. I know he’s a good lad and I think maybe a bit of help [is what he needs].”
When asked if Hazard needed a rest in order to rediscover his form, Lampard replied: “I don’t know about a rest, I’d like to see him playing regularly.
“He has to work hard to get out of this, make no mistake about that. If Chelsea are going to turn the corner and get up towards the Champions League positions, which they have to, they need Eden Hazard at his best and I think you’ve got to go with him, put your arm around him, try and help him get to that level we know he can do.”
